INTRODUCTION AND GENERAL INDEX
PIEDMONT DIRECTORY CO., publishers of Miller's Asheville City Di- rectory (publisher of the Asheville City Directory since 1899), present to sub- scribers and the general public, this, the 1954 edition, which also includes Beverly Hills, Biltmore Forest, Broadview Park, East Biltmore, Gentry Park, Lakeview Terrace, Linwood Park, Martel Mill Village, Morningside, Oakley, Oaklyn Park, Sayles Village, South Biltmore and Woodfin.
Confidence in the continued growth of Asheville's industry, population and wealth, and in the advancement of its civic and social activities, will be maintained as sections of this Directory are consulted, for the Directory is a mirror truly reflecting Asheville to the world.
The enviable position occupied by the Asheville City Directory in the es- timation of the public, has been established by rendering the best in Directory service. With an unrivaled organization, and having had the courteous and hearty cooperation of the business and professional men and residents, the publishers feel that the result of their labors will meet with the approval of every user, and that the Asheville Directory will fulfill its mission as a source of. authentic information pertaining to the community.
Five Major Departments (Each department beginning with Page 1)
The five departments are arranged in the following order :-
I. THE ALPHABETICAL LIST OF NAMES of residents and business and professional concerns is the first major department, printed on white paper. This is the only record in existence that aims to show the name, marital status, occupation and address of each adult resident of Asheville and vicinity, and the name, official personnel, nature and address of each firm and corpo- ration.
II. THE BUYERS' GUIDE, the second major department, printed on gold- enrod paper, contains the advertisements of leading manufacturing, business and professional interests of Asheville and vicinity. The advertisements are indexed under headings descriptive of the business represented. This is refer- ence advertising at its best, and merits a survey by all buyers eager to famil- iarize themselves with sources of supply. In a progressive community and famous resort like Asheville, the necessity of having this kind of information immediately available, is obvious. General appreciation of this fact is evi- denced by the many reference users of this City Directory service.
III. THE CLASSIFIED BUSINESS DIRECTORY is the third major depart- ment, printed on yellow paper. This department lists the names of all busi- ness and professional concerns in alphabetical order under appropriate head- ings. This feature constitutes an invaluable and indispensable catalog of the numerous interests of the community. The Directory is the common inter- mediary between buyer and seller. As such it plays an important part in the daily activities of the commercial and professional world. More buyers and sellers meet through the Classified Business Directory than through any other medium.
IV. THE DIRECTORY OF HOUSEHOLDERS, INCLUDING STREET AND AVENUE GUIDE, on pink paper, is the fourth major department. In this section the numbered streets are arranged in numerical order, followed by the named streets in alphabetical order; the numbers of the residences and business concerns are arranged in numerical order under the name of each street, and the names of the householders and concerns are placed oppo- site the numbers. The names of the intersecting streets appear at their re- spective crossing points on each street. Special features of this section are the designation of tenant-owned homes and the designation of homes and places of business having telephones.

V. THE NUMERICAL TELEPHONE DIRECTORY, on blue paper, is the fifth major department.
Community Publicity
The Directory reflects the achievements and ambitions of the community, depicting in unbiased terms what it has to offer as a place of residence, as a business location, as a resort, as a manufacturing site and as an educational center. To broadcast this information, the publishers have placed copies of this issue of the Directory in Directory Libraries, where they are readily available for free public reference, and serve as perpetual and reliable ad- vertisements of Asheville and vicinity.
The Asheville Directory Library
Through the courtesy of the publishers of the Asheville City Directory, a Directory Library is maintained in the offices of the Asheville Chamber of Commerce, for free reference by the general public. This is one of more than 600 Directory Libraries installed in the chief cities of the U. S. and Canada by members of the Association of North American Directory Publish- ers, under whose supervision the system is operated.

ASHEVILLE
"IN THE LAND OF THE SKY"-"EASTERN GATEWAY CITY TO THE GREAT SMOKY MOUNTAINS NATIONAL PARK"
(Courtesy Asheville Chamber of Commerce)
Statistical Review
Form of Government-Council-manager.
Population-City proper, 53, 000; metropolitan area, 124, 403 (1950 U. S. Census).
Area-14. 7 square miles.
Altitude -- 2, 340 feet above sea level.
Climate-Mean annual temperature, 55. 8 degrees F .; average annual rainfall, 38. 11 inches.
Parks-15, with total of 419. 6 acres, valued at $516, 529.
Assessed Valuation-$76, 106, 061 (1952), with $3. 56 per $100 tax rate. Financial Data-4 commercial banks. Clearings for 1952, $756, 152, - 203. 51.
Postal Receipts-$814, 537. 03 (1952).
Telephones in Service-26, 551.
Churches-128, representing 15 denominations.
Industry-Chief industries of city and surrounding territory: Resort busi- ness, manufacturing, lumber and tobacco. Principal manufactured products of city and vicinity: Blankets, cotton and yard goods, flour and feed, furni- ture, leather goods, mica products, packing products, fine papers, printing and publishing products, cigarette papers, rayon yarn, cellophane, and elec- tronic devices.
Trade Area-Retail area covers 19 counties, with total population of 497, 577.
Newspapers-2 dailies, combined as one paper on Sunday, and 2 weeklies. Hotels-9. Also 51 motor courts.
Railroads-Southern.
Highways-U. S. 19, 23, 25, 70 and 74, 13, 284 miles of hard-surfaced roads in the state. The Blue Ridge Parkway from Shenandoah National Park to Great Smoky Mountains National Park is virtually completed from Roanoke to Asheville.

Airports-The Asheville-Hendersonville Airport, located at Fletcher, south of Asheville. Handling flights of Delta, Capital and Piedmont air lines, its new terminal building houses the Strato Chef Food Bar and the Interstate Airways Communication Station of the CAA. This airport has 3 paved run- ways, 4, 000 feet long, and a complete lighting system for night flying. Air Traffic Control Tower. It is well equipped with 3 large hangars, licensed mechanics and instructors, and 2 flying service operations which have 61 approved training schools, air taxi service and aerial photography. The high- way direction signs starting at the Langren Hotel clearly mark the route down Biltmore Ave., turning left in Biltmore and out the Sweeten Creek Road to the airport.
Amusements-Largest auditorium in city seats 3, 000 persons. 7 moving- picture theatres, with total seating capacity of 5, 300 persons. Also 4 drive-in theatres. 4 golf courses.
Hospitals-4 general, with total of 416 beds.
Education-Institutions of higher learning include St. Genevieve-of-the- Pines, Asheville School for Boys, Asheville-Biltmore College and Plonk School of Creative Arts. 16 public schools, including 1 senior high school, 2 junior high schools and 8 elementary schools for whites, and 1 senior high school and 4 elementary schools for Negroes. 2 parochial schools. Number of pupils in public schools, 8, 171; teachers, 303. Value of public school pro- perty, $10, 000, 000.
City Statistics-Total street mileage, 213, with 165 miles paved. Miles of gas mains, 94; sewers, 181. Number of water meters, 18, 988, light me- ters, 31, 000; gas meters, 3, 751. Capacity of water works, 550, 000, 000 gal- lons; daily average use, approximately 10, 000, 000 gallons; flow by gravity; miles of mains, 290; value of plant, $7, 750, 000. Fire department has 82 men, with 6 stations and 14 pieces of motor equipment. Value of fire depart- ment property, $300, 000. Police department has 82 men, with 1 station and 16 pieces of motor equipment.
